Is My School District a Bully?
The news is filled with stories of parents who peaceably assemble before school boards for a redress of grievances only to find they are labeled domestic terrorists or at the very least ne'er do wells. During the Mid-term pushback victories parents are more aware of educational issues and how to successfully advocate for their children.
The first step for any parent to understand is whether your school district is a bully or not. Some parents have been banned entirely from their children's education but most often elements of the curriculum that parents object to are ignored or their concerns minimized. Included in this list are divisive and un-American indoctrination concerning CRT, pronouns, equity, social justice, LGBTQ+, BLM, drag shows, in short, any instruction that aims to create activists rather than academically prepare children. Well meaning teachers are free to advocate any social cause they are passionate about but they violate parent's rights as primary educators of their children once they cross the line into recruiting students.
You will have a sense of whether you are being bullied or not if you have raised concerns with a teacher, principal, or ultimately a school board. If you do not obtain satisfaction for your concerns it is time for you to call in allies.

Changing Names
Anne Bancroft is a classic example. Her real name was Anna Maria Italiano, and she was told outright that it was, well, too Italiano, and she'd never have a successful acting career with that name. So she changed it to Anne Marno (Marno being a combination of her middle and last names).
Nope, they said. Still too “ethnic-sounding”. So she chose “Bancroft”, because, she said, she thought it sounded “dignified”. (I bet Mel Brooks would still have married her no matter what her name was, though.)
The same story happened over and over; non-Anglo people took Anglo stage names in the hope of it increasing their chances of Hollywood success.
So Issur Danielovitch became Kirk Douglas.
Volodimyr Palahniuk became Jack Palance.
Tadeusz Konopka became Ted Knight.
Charles Bunchinsky became Charles Bronson.
Jacob Julius Garfinkle became John Garfield.
Margarita Carmen Cansino became Rita Hayworth.
Alphonso D'Abruzzo became Alan Alda.
Emanuel Goldenberg became Edward G. Robinson.
Frederick Austerlitz became Fred Astaire.
Dino Crocetti became Dean Martin.
Bernard Schwartz became Tony Curtis.
